The Schmidt Glacier is a 1.1 km long glacier in the west of the island of Heard in the southern Indian Ocean . It flows west of the Baudissin Glacier between Mount Drygalski and the North West Cornice ridge .

Participants in the German Gauss expedition (1901–1903) under the direction of Erich von Drygalski carried out a rough mapping in 1902. Drygalski named him after the ministerial official Dr. J. Schmidt for assisting the government in soliciting support for the expedition.
